Report: Bell not expected to return to Steelers for Week 3 of preseason

While Le'Veon Bell will reportedly return to the Pittsburgh Steelers before the regular season begins, the running back is expected to stay away from the team for Week 3 of the preseason, a source told ESPN's Jeremy Fowler.

The source added to Fowler, however, they would be surprised if Bell didn't return shortly after that.

Bell has yet to sign the $12.12-million franchise tag, so he isn't facing any fines for missing the preseason.

The Steelers and Bell were unable to agree to a long-term deal this offseason, leading to the fifth-year runner staying away from all activities and training camp.

Bell reportedly turned down a five-year contract worth $12 million annually and said he's looking to reinvigorate the running back market with his next deal.
